Factors Impacting Cost
Cedar roof installation in North Billerica, MA, involves selecting appropriate materials, understanding project scope, and navigating local permitting processes. This overview provides a general understanding of typical project aspects to consider when exploring cedar roofing options in the area.
- Materials: Premium cedar shingles or shakes are commonly used, with options varying in thickness and grade to suit different aesthetic and durability preferences.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small repairs to full roof replacements, typically covering standard residential roof sizes in North Billerica.
- Labor Complexity: Installation requires skilled craftsmanship due to the need for precise fitting and fastening, especially on complex roof geometries.
- Permitting: Local building permits are generally required for new installations or major replacements, with adherence to town codes and regulations.
- Additional Features: Optional extras may include underlayment upgrades, ridge ventilation, or protective coatings to extend roof lifespan and performance.
